E85 adaptation (no Stage 1)
Just the fuel switch: the ECU is adapted to run Superéthanol E85
(up to 85% bio-ethanol) with no Stage 1 chip on top. You get a small
power bump from ethanol's higher octane (~104 RON) and a much cheaper
fill-up. Fully reversible; the car still runs on regular petrol
whenever you want.

E85 + Stage 1 remap
Chip tuning re-optimised for Superéthanol E85: the ignition and
boost maps are calibrated to make full use of ethanol's higher octane
(~104 RON). Bigger power and torque gains than either Stage 1 on petrol
or E85 adaptation alone, plus the same cheap fill-up.
